Web Design and UX Design

Introduction

Web design and UX design are a fundamental part of creating a successful website. It is a process that involves analyzing user needs, designing the user interface, evaluating usability, and creating an optimal user experience. Web design and UX design are closely related, but they also have some important differences.

Web Design

Web design is a process that involves creating a website, from designing the user interface to coding the site. The web design process includes researching and analyzing user needs, designing the user interface, creating an optimal user experience, and optimizing the website for search engines. Web design is a complex process that requires a wide range of skills, including knowledge of programming languages, understanding of user interface design principles, knowledge of search engines, and understanding of user needs.

UX Design

UX design is a process that focuses on creating an optimal user experience for website users. UX design includes researching user needs, designing the user interface, evaluating usability, and creating an optimal user experience. UX design is a process that requires a wide range of skills, including understanding of user interface design principles, knowledge of programming languages, understanding of user needs, and knowledge of search engines.

Differences Between Web Design and UX Design

Although web design and UX design are closely related, there are some important differences. Web design is a broader process that includes user interface design, website coding, search engine optimization, and creating an optimal user experience. UX design, on the other hand, is a more focused process that concentrates on creating an optimal user experience. While web design is a more technical process, UX design is a more creative process that requires a deeper understanding of user needs.
